Output 75a09c64ef8d0fabddcd011ee8eca53225e4cec29a38373103e12d17c3eb0f9f:0

value
1685263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 083bc6562d7e35294c87e63edcfb0f859eb8470f OP_EQUAL
address
32SYwJQrDmRLzDThWS4W26Laq6cNJzCXvs
transaction
75a09c64ef8d0fabddcd011ee8eca53225e4cec29a38373103e12d17c3eb0f9f